-- ------------------------------------------------------------------ -- Build the SAPS-II severity score on a vanilla PostgreSQL MIMIC-III v1.3 DB. -- -- Usage (assuming you have already restored the MIMIC-III dump into a -- database called `mimic` and have the base tables in the `mimiciii` schema): -- -- psql -d mimic -v ON_ERROR_STOP=1 \ -- -c 'SET search_path TO mimiciii, public;' \ -- -f sql/build_sapsii.sql -- -- Resulting tables created in the current search_path: -- urine_output (not used by SAPS-II directly, -- included for completeness) -- ventilation_classification -- ventilation_durations -- blood_gas_first_day -- blood_gas_first_day_arterial -- gcs_first_day -- labs_first_day -- urine_output_first_day -- vitals_first_day -- sapsii <-- final score table -- ------------------------------------------------------------------ \set ON_ERROR_STOP on -- 0. PL/pgSQL shims for BigQuery-style DATETIME_DIFF / DATETIME_ADD / DATETIME_SUB \i postgres-functions.sql -- 1. Optional helper view (not required by SAPS-II, but useful and harmless) \i fluid_balance/urine_output.sql -- 2. Ventilation: classification first, then durations \i durations/ventilation_classification.sql \i durations/ventilation_durations.sql -- 3. First-day derived views (blood_gas_first_day must precede the arterial one) \i firstday/blood_gas_first_day.sql \i firstday/blood_gas_first_day_arterial.sql \i firstday/gcs_first_day.sql \i firstday/labs_first_day.sql \i firstday/urine_output_first_day.sql \i firstday/vitals_first_day.sql -- 4. The score itself \i severityscores/sapsii.sql \echo 'SAPS-II build complete. Query results with: SELECT * FROM sapsii LIMIT 10;'
